The Phillies' midseason dismissal of Rob Thomson on April 28, 2026, after a dismal 9-19 start and MLB-worst run differential, opened a search for his permanent successor following Don Mattingly's interim appointment. Trader consensus reflects a crowded field of experienced candidates, with Brad Ausmus, Mattingly, George Lombard, and Alex Cora clustered within roughly four points due to overlapping managerial pedigrees, recent bench-coach or coordinator roles, and alignment with president Dave Dombrowski's preference for steady leadership amid a high-payroll roster featuring strong starting pitching. Recent form, internal promotions, and external availability keep the implied probabilities competitive, as no frontrunner has pulled away in the early weeks of the search.

If no permanent manager is appointed by January 31, 2027, 11:59 PM ET, the market will resolve to "Other."
Appointments of 'interim,' 'caretaker,' or other non-permanent managers will not impact this market's resolution.
An announcement of a new permanent manager's appointment before this market's close date will immediately resolve this market to the corresponding option, regardless of when the announced appointment goes into effect.
The primary resolution source for this market will be official information from the Philadelphia Phillies; however, a consensus of credible reporting may also be used.
